Milton Keynes is a large town in the north of Buckinghamshire, and is also the borough within which the town sits. The vast majority of economic activity in the area (much like most other UK cities) relates to the service industry. Milton Keynes solicitor firms offer a full range of legal services, but as the area has one of the higher income level averages, certain types of legal expertise are more in-demand than others.
For example, many Milton Keynes solicitor firms offer estate planning, wills and probate advice. The demand for such services obviously increases when individuals have large estates. Additionally, family and divorce services are often offered by Milton Keynes solicitor firms. This is not related to a higher divorce rate, but rather to the fact that the more an individual’s net worth is, the more likely it is that the costs of hiring a solicitor will be financially justified.
The area of Milton Keynes is known in the legal world because of the landmark case of Halsey vs Milton Keynes General NHS Trust (2004). The case clarified the importance of mediation, and the relationship between ADR (Alternative Dispute Resolution) and a court decision regarding the payment of costs in a case. The general rule is that the losing party should pay the costs of the winning party, unless the winning party acted unreasonably and in doing so avoided mediation. The case also provides specific guidelines in order to establish when refusing mediation is reasonable.
